How to fill out payment vs clearing vs:

01
Understand the concept of payment: Payment refers to the transfer of funds or settlement of a financial transaction between a buyer and a seller. It can be done through various methods such as cash, credit cards, online payment platforms, or bank transfers. When filling out payment details, make sure to provide accurate and complete information to ensure a successful transaction.
02
Familiarize yourself with clearing: Clearing is the process of reconciling and settling financial transactions between multiple parties. It involves verifying the details of a payment, such as the amount, the payer, and the recipient. Clearing ensures that all parties involved in a transaction have fulfilled their obligations and that the payment can proceed smoothly.
